18:等差数列末项计算

简介: 18:等差数列末项计算

描述

给出一个等差数列的前两项a1,a2,求第n项是多少。

输入

一行,包含三个整数a1,a2,n。-100 <= a1,a2 <= 100,0 < n <= 1000。

输出

一个整数,即第n项的值。

样例输入

1 4 100

样例输出

298

源码

#include <stdio.h>
int main()
{
    int a1,a2;
    int n;
    scanf("%d %d %d",&a1,&a2,&n);
    int x;
    x=a1+(n-1)*(a2-a1);
    printf("%d",x);
}

以上代码仅供参考


目录
相关文章
|
6月前
|
存储 算法 程序员
平方根倒数快速算法
平方根倒数快速算法
71 0
|
25天前
计算自然数的和
【10月更文挑战第18天】计算自然数的和。
26 10
|
23天前
通过最大公约数计算
【10月更文挑战第20天】通过最大公约数计算。
28 5
|
5月前
|
机器学习/深度学习 算法 Serverless
利用无穷级数逼近计算幂运算与开根号——Python实现
使用泰勒级数逼近法,本文介绍了如何用Python计算特殊幂运算,包括分数次幂和开根号。通过定义辅助函数,如`exp`、`getN_minus_n`、`multi`和`getnum`,实现了计算任意实数次幂的功能。实验结果显示,算法能有效计算不同情况下的幂运算,例如`0.09^2`、`1^2`、`0.25^2`、`0.09^(0.5)`、`1^(0.5)`和`0.25^(0.5)`。虽然精度可能有限,但可通过调整迭代次数平衡精度与计算速度。
|
5月前
|
机器学习/深度学习 存储 人工智能
每日练习之矩阵乘法——斐波那契公约数
每日练习之矩阵乘法——斐波那契公约数
39 0
|
6月前
|
人工智能
游游的选数乘积
游游的选数乘积
53 3
|
C++
C++ 超大整数相加、相乘的精确求解,以及10000的阶乘
C++ 超大整数相加、相乘的精确求解,以及10000的阶乘
115 0
leetcode-829. 连续整数求和(数论)
这题求连续正整数,刚好满足等差数列,可以用等差数列求和公式 n = (i + (i + k)) * (k + 1) / 2 其中i是连续正整数的首项,k是尾项和首项的差值
112 0
leetcode-829. 连续整数求和(数论)